Data centres sit at the heart of modern business, powering everything from banking systems and healthcare records to cloud services and government operations. A breach isn’t just a technical problem it’s a physical one too. Robust data centre security protects the servers, systems, and people that keep critical infrastructure running, and safeguards the sensitive data housed within it.
As data centres grow in scale and importance across the UK and Ireland, physical security has become just as critical as cybersecurity. A single unauthorised entry, act of sabotage, or unmanaged emergency can disrupt services relied upon by thousands of businesses and millions of people.
Data centre security involves the physical measures used to protect a facility, its equipment, and its data from unauthorised access, theft, sabotage, and other threats. This typically includes security guards, access control, CCTV surveillance, perimeter protection, alarm systems, and incident response procedures working together.
Cybersecurity often takes centre stage in conversations about protecting digital infrastructure, but physical access to a data centre can bypass even the most sophisticated cyber defences. If someone can walk into a server room, they can potentially steal hardware, install malicious devices, or cause damage that no firewall can prevent.

Data centres face a distinct set of physical and operational risks that must be identified and managed as part of any data centre security risk assessment.
Individuals gaining entry to the facility, or to restricted zones within it, without proper authorisation — whether through stolen credentials, tailgating, or exploiting weak entry procedures.
Servers, drives, networking equipment, and other valuable hardware are attractive targets, particularly in facilities with inadequate access control or monitoring.
Intentional damage to equipment, cabling, or infrastructure, which can cause costly downtime and repair expenses.
Deliberate interference with systems or infrastructure, potentially by disgruntled employees, contractors, or external actors seeking to disrupt operations.
Forced or unauthorised entry into the facility itself, bypassing perimeter or entry-point security.
Employees, contractors, or vendors with legitimate access who misuse that access, whether through negligence or malicious intent.
Gaps or weaknesses in fencing, barriers, or site boundaries that allow unauthorised individuals onto the site.
Accidental or deliberate damage to critical hardware, cooling systems, or power infrastructure, which can compromise uptime.
Fires, power failures, severe weather, or other emergencies that require rapid, coordinated response to protect people and equipment.

Building a comprehensive data centre security management plan requires a structured approach. Here’s how organisers and facility managers should approach it.
Identify the specific threats facing your facility, considering its location, size, client base, and the sensitivity of the data and systems it houses.
Map out which servers, systems, and areas are most critical to operations and would cause the greatest impact if compromised.
Establish clear zones — general access, restricted, and highly restricted — based on the sensitivity of what’s housed within each area.
Determine who needs access to which areas, and implement systems (keycards, biometrics, multi-factor authentication) to enforce this.
Identify which areas require CCTV coverage, and ensure cameras cover entry points, corridors, server rooms, and perimeters without gaps.
Decide on staffing levels and shift patterns, considering whether 24/7 coverage is required and what response times are needed.
Create clear protocols for fires, intrusions, power failures, and other emergencies, including evacuation and lockdown procedures.
Establish a clear process for logging, reporting, and reviewing security incidents, near-misses, and anomalies.
Revisit the plan periodically and after any incident to ensure it remains effective as the facility, staffing, and threat landscape evolve.

Data centre security refers to the physical measures used to protect a facility, its equipment, and its data from unauthorised access, theft, sabotage, and other threats. It typically includes security guards, access control systems, CCTV, perimeter protection, and incident response procedures.
Physical security is important because gaining physical access to a facility can bypass even strong cybersecurity measures. Protecting the building, equipment, and restricted areas helps prevent theft, sabotage, and unauthorised access to sensitive systems and data.
Data centres commonly use a combination of security guards, access control systems, CCTV surveillance, perimeter protection, visitor management procedures, alarm systems, and security patrols, working together as a layered security strategy.
Many data centres benefit from professional security guards, particularly for access control, patrols, and incident response. Whether guards are required, and in what numbers, depends on the facility's size, risk profile, and the sensitivity of the systems it houses.
CCTV provides continuous visual monitoring of entry points, corridors, and restricted areas, helping to deter unauthorised activity and providing a recorded history that supports incident investigation and review.
A data centre security risk assessment identifies the specific physical and operational threats facing a facility — such as unauthorised access, theft, or sabotage — and determines appropriate control measures to reduce those risks.
Unauthorised access can be reduced through layered measures such as perimeter protection, access control systems (keycards, biometrics), visitor management procedures, CCTV monitoring, and trained security personnel managing entry points.
Threats to data centres can occur at any time, and critical infrastructure often needs to remain operational around the clock. Continuous monitoring and staffing help ensure that incidents are identified and responded to without delay, at any hour.
